Sacred Heart was founded by the Daughters of Charity in 1915. While our technology has improved dramatically and the buildings have grown and expanded, our commitment to the mission remains steadfast: to provide excellent health care to all people, with special attention to the poor and vulnerable. For our more than 100-year history, we have been blessed with talented associates who believe in our mission and are dedicated to serving our patients and families.
Sacred Heart Health System includes hospital campuses in Pensacola, Miramar Beach and Port St. Joe, Florida, as well as The Studer Family Children’s Hospital at Sacred Heart – Northwest Florida’s only children’s hospital – and Sacred Heart Medical Group, the largest network of primary care and specialty physicians in Northwest Florida. In affiliation with the University of Florida, Sacred Heart offers the region’s only kidney transplant program, as well as physician residency programs to train the next generation of doctors in internal medicine, pediatrics and obstetrics/gynecology.

Job Description
Job Summary:
The RN - Med/Surg provides direct nursing care to medical-surgical patients in accordance with established policies, procedures and protocols of the healthcare organization.
Responsibilities:
- Implements and monitors patient care plans. Monitors, records and communicates patient condition as appropriate.
- Serves as a primary coordinator of all disciplines for well-coordinated patient care.
- Notes and carries out physician and nursing orders.
- Assesses and coordinates patient's discharge planning needs with members of the healthcare team.
- Participates in performance improvement initiatives as appropriate
- Performs other duties as assigned.
Qualifications
Licenses/Certifications/Registration:
Required Credential(s):- Advanced Life Support specializing in Advanced Cardio Life Support credentialed from the American Heart Association (AHA) obtained within 6 Months (180 days) of hire date or job transfer date.
- BLS Provider specializing in Basic Life Support credentialed from the American Heart Association (AHA) obtained prior to hire date or job transfer date.
- Licensed Registered Nurse credentialed from the Florida Board of Nursing obtained prior to hire date or job transfer date.
Preferred Credential(s):- Certified Registered Nurse specializing in Chemotherapy credentialed from the Oncology Nursing Society (ONS).
Education:
- Diploma
- Graduate of a Registered Nursing program required.
Work Experience:
- Previous clinical experience preferred.
- One year of experience as a Staff Registered Nurse is required to work PRN.
